Product Description

Clamp to spreader conversion is a breeze with the new Quick-Change button.
New swivel jaws that can be removed and non-marring pads
Even when under extreme pressure, the I-beam bar reduces bending and flexing.
Clamping pressure of 300 lbs. for an extended period of time
The clamp is released instantly with a one-handed Quick-Release trigger.

These handy clamps helped me repair a broken kitchen cabinet door! I wish I had purchased these a long time ago
5/5

A kitchen cabinet door had split in two and I needed to replace it. I used two of these clamps to hold the assembly together after glueing it together. They're simple to use: open the clamps to the desired width with the release lever, then tighten the clamp onto the work with the tightening lever. When you're finished with the project, simply press the release lever to release the clamps. The clamps can also be used as spreaders, which is a nice feature. The fixed end clamp head is simply released from the bar by pressing a button on the fixed end clamp head. Re-attach the clamp head to the bar by reversing it. Slide the clamp grip off the bar, then reverse the direction and slide it back onto the bar, using the release lever on the hand grip as a guide. Clamps come with only a small cardboard information sheet, which you can remove by unscrewing the rubber head of the clamp, removing the paper, and reinstalling the rubber head.

Very strong
5/5

I was hesitant to buy these for a long time because of the price, but I kept running into situations where the spreader feature would have come in handy, so I finally gave in and bought them. Now that I have them in my hands, the cost appears to be much more reasonable. These are much more durable than the older 12" and 18" versions that I have. The bar is thicker and has an I-shape. The plastic parts are made of a much tougher plastic than the beam profile. br>br>The spreader feature is exactly what I expected it to be, and it's simple to use. However, I was initially perplexed as to how it worked: Instead of removing and flipping each piece, simply move the fixed arm to the opposite end of the bar. It's simple to do, but it hasn't shown any signs of coming loose on its own. Irwin, you did an excellent job. br>br>Another nice feature is that the pad on the fixed arm has a switch: It can be locked parallel to the other pad, or it can pivot a small amount in either direction to improve grip when clamping something that isn't perfectly square. br>br>Now that I've tried them, I'm pretty sure I'll need at least one more pair.

For medium pressure, it's quick and simple
4/5

When I'm working alone, I like to use the quick grip clamps. It provides a quick and easy initial clamp for holding things in place while I set up my traditional bar or pipe clamps. I've had a few of these for years and enjoy them, so I decided to add to my collection by purchasing another. While the clamp still performs admirably, it is noticeably lighter and flimsier. Because I'm afraid of breaking the handle on this newer model, I'm not squeezing it as hard as I would on the older one. With the old one, I never hesitated to squeeze as hard as I could. This is still a fantastic product, but I'm not convinced it's as reliable as previous generations.
